Are permeable pavers better than wood for patio construction in our climate?

Permeable concrete pavers offer 25-30 year lifespans versus wood's 10-15 years in Zone 5b freeze-thaw cycles. Their 5-8% void space manages stormwater while meeting Low Fire Wise Rating requirements through non-combustible materials. Proper installation includes 4-inch crushed stone base with geogrid reinforcement, creating stable surfaces that withstand -20°F winters without heaving. This approach eliminates wood's decay and termite vulnerabilities while maintaining defensible space around structures.

What's the best solution for seasonal ponding in my clay-heavy yard?

Moderate ponding in silty clay loam requires integrated drainage strategies. Permeable concrete pavers achieve 5-10 inch per hour infiltration rates, exceeding Vermilion County Planning & Zoning Department's 3-inch minimum for runoff control. Install French drains with 4-inch perforated pipe at 1% slope, surrounded by washed gravel and geotextile fabric. These systems redirect 80-90% of surface water while maintaining soil structure through controlled percolation.

How can I reduce maintenance while supporting local biodiversity?

Transition 30-50% of high-maintenance turf to native plantings like Purple Coneflower, Little Bluestem, Butterfly Milkweed, and Wild Bergamot. These species require 75% less water than traditional lawns and support 8-12 native pollinator species. Electric maintenance equipment operates below 65 decibels, complying with noise ordinances while eliminating gas emissions. This approach creates self-sustaining ecosystems that thrive in Zone 5b without chemical inputs.
